WebFeb 2, 2005 · The Tree Planting campaign was launched by the government in 1963 with the objective of making Singapore a green city.1 Every year a minimum of 10,000 saplings are planted as part of this campaign. The campaign includes an annual Tree Planting Day.2 History Colonial Period WebSep 4, 2024 · Koh Lian Pin, National University of Singapore Reforestation has long been a strategy against climate change.
